Oscar Collazo Stops Haro And Targets Rematch With Jerusalem!


In his latest tour of duty, unified minimumweight champion Oscar “El Pupilo” Collazo (14-0, 11 KO’s) fought and stopped overwhelmed challenger Jesus “Chiquito” Haro (13-4, 2 KO’s). The duel stood as Collazo’s third defense of the WBA strap and seventh of his WBO title.

Haro was ill-equipped to overthrow the champion. Following six rounds of being hammered in various tender gut parts, Chiquito abruptly quit on his stool. Before leaving the ring, Collazo made it clear that it was his intention to collect the final two belts to become the undisputed champion of the division.

Going a step further, El Pupilo let it be known that he meant to first target WBC 105-pound champion Melvin “El Gringo” Jerusalem (25-3, 12 KO’s). Collazo originally defeated Jerusalem back on May 27, 2023 to initially take possession of the WBO title. It will be revealing to see how Team Jerusalem responds to this public declaration. Or will Collazo slide through the ring ropes to face IBF minimumweight champion Pedro Taduran? Only time will tell.
